One of the primary advantages of perforated metal filters is their exceptional durability. Constructed from robust materials, such as stainless steel or carbon steel, these filters are designed to withstand harsh environments, including high temperatures and corrosive substances. This characteristic is particularly beneficial in industries like oil and gas, food processing, and wastewater treatment, where the filters must endure challenging operational conditions. As a result, investing in perforated metal filters translates to long-term cost savings, as they require less frequent replacements compared to traditional filters.
Another significant benefit is the customization options available with perforated metal filters. Buyers can select from various hole sizes, shapes, and arrangements, allowing for tailored solutions that meet specific filtration needs. This customization not only enhances the performance of the filtering system but also aligns it with the particular requirements of the application, whether it involves air, liquid, or solid filtration. Manufacturers often work closely with customers to develop filters that maximize efficiency while meeting regulatory and operational requirements.
Perforated metal filters also offer outstanding airflow and liquid flow capacity. The perforations are strategically placed to create minimal resistance while ensuring optimal fluid movement. This characteristic is crucial in applications such as HVAC systems, chemical processing, and automotive industries where maintaining flow rates is essential for efficiency. The filtering performance is enhanced as the design allows contaminants to be captured effectively without restricting throughput.
Additionally, the maintenance and cleaning of perforated metal filters are comparatively straightforward. Their structural integrity and resilience to damage make them easier to clean than fabric or paper filters. Users can wash, scrub, or blow out accumulated debris and contaminants, prolonging the life of the filter and ensuring consistent performance. This easy maintenance reduces downtime and operational costs associated with filter changes and replacements.

Cost-effectiveness is another compelling reason to consider perforated metal filters. While the initial investment may be higher than disposable options, their durability and longevity yield significant savings over time. The reduced need for replacements, combined with lower maintenance costs, makes these filters an economically sound choice for businesses looking to optimize their filtration processes. Additionally, with the rise of global sourcing, companies can find competitive prices and a range of options that suit their budgetary constraints.
Environmentally conscious buyers will also appreciate the sustainability aspect of perforated metal filters. Their reusability translates to less waste than single-use filters, aligning with contemporary sustainable practices. As businesses strive to minimize their environmental impact, opting for durable and reusable filtration solutions can play a significant role in achieving these goals.
